South Korean Youth Protests Supporting Yoon Suk-yeol

Thousands of young people in South Korea have taken to the streets to protest the imprisonment of former President Yoon Suk-yeol, claiming his attempt at martial law was justified to prevent a Chinese takeover. The "Freedom University" group and other Gen Z protesters have adopted "Make Korea Great Again" style hats and anti-immigration rhetoric. The movement reflects a growing nationalist sentiment among South Korean youth who feel disenfranchised by "woke" politics.

South Korean President Yoon Suk-yeol Arrested

South Korean President Yoon Suk-yeol was arrested on Wednesday following a failed attempt to declare martial law in December 2024. Yoon is facing charges of insurrection and was detained by the Corruption Investigation Office (CIO) after a standoff at his residence. The president claims the investigation is illegal and intended to prevent "unsavory bloodshed" during the political crisis.

South Korean Martial Law and Election Commission Raid

South Korean President Yoon Suk-yeol briefly declared martial law, a move that was overturned by Parliament within six hours. Reports from "boots on the ground" suggest the declaration served as a smokescreen for an elite special forces raid on the National Election Commission to seize servers and phones. The incident has led to impeachment proceedings against Yoon amid allegations of election fraud and political instability.
